How to Check Battery Life Before Buying

When inspecting a used Apple Watch, you should verify the battery health to determine its remaining capacity and potential lifespan. Here are key steps to follow:

  • Ensure the watch is turned on and functional.
  • Open the Settings app on the watch.
  • Navigate to Battery > Battery Health.
  • Check the Maximum Capacity percentage.

A healthy battery typically has a capacity close to 100%. If the capacity is below 80%, the battery may need replacement soon, which can affect performance and battery life.

Interpreting Battery Health Data

Understanding what the battery health numbers mean helps you make an informed decision:

  • Above 90%: Excellent condition, minimal degradation.
  • 80-90%: Good condition, some degradation but still reliable.
  • Below 80%: Noticeable degradation, consider potential replacement.

Additional Checks for Battery Performance

Beyond battery health percentage, observe the following:

  • Perform a full charge and monitor how long the watch lasts during typical use.
  • Check for rapid battery drain during usage.
  • Ensure the watch charges normally without issues.

Tips for Maintaining Battery Life

If you decide to purchase a used Apple Watch, consider these tips to extend its battery life:

  • Keep software updated to optimize battery performance.
  • Limit background app refresh and notifications if not needed.
  • Reduce screen brightness and auto-lock time.
  • Avoid exposing the watch to extreme temperatures.
